If all houseplants were as difficult as the snakeplant, there would certainly be no reason for the foliage plant industry.


Well, perhaps that is Discover More Here an overstatement, but except submerging the origins in stagnant water for months at a time or a sudden freeze when you neglect to bring it in from a wintertime "sunning", it is nearly unbreakable. There are two typical versions of snakeplant, the green-leafed form has grey cross-bands.

They arise from an iris-like rhizome. Its variegated counterpart, Laurentii, has a yellow band to the fallen leaves. The dwarf kind, birdsnest snakeplant, expands in a rosette just 6 inches high. Snakeplant belongs to the century plant family, and like other members of this family, hails from desert regions, in this case southern Africa.

Sansevieria is a great initial plant for kids since its durability instills self-confidence, its slow development teaches perseverance and all kinds of interesting things can be performed with it. Among the common names for sansevieria is bow-string hemp, extracted from the truth click to find out more that Africans used the fibers from the plant to generate the strings for their bows.

Snakeplants can likewise be propagated from leaf cuttings with fallen leaves reduced into three-inch long sectors and these after that embeded dirt with the bottom end down. In about 3 months, the plants will root and send up a brand-new shoot. If the variegated form is proliferated, it will produce a normal eco-friendly shoot because the plant is a chimera a sort of mutation.

The Florida vegetation plant market had its start growing these plants for circulation to that chain. Snakeplants survive in around as low a light level as you would certainly experience in the home.


They don't need a great deal of water and fertilization seems optional, at the very least when the plant is inside. If you desire your plant to grow, relocate it to the patio in the summer season and give it a periodic shot of fertilizer and a periodic watering. Keep snakeplants rootbound for finest effect.
